The Queensland Government has introduced a levy to offenders sentenced in a Queensland court
The purpose of the levy is to help pay for the cost of law enforcement and administration.
The levy is not an order of the court and does not form any part of the sentence imposed by a judge or magistrate.
The levy is payable on each sentencing event.
The amounts for the levy are:
Magistrates Court – $100
Supreme and District Courts – $300
The levy does not apply to children.
The levy is enforceable through the State Penalties Enforcement Registry (SPER)
